Use the Story block to combine photos and videos to create an engaging, tappable, full-screen slideshow on your site’s posts and pages. In this guide you’ll learn how to add stories to your WordPress site.

About stories on WordPress

On WordPress, stories appear as a block in a blog post. The Story block displays a preview of the story content where the first slide is the cover image. Stories can be a great method to display:

  • Step-by-step guides and tutorials
  • Recipes
  • Showcasing progress on your DIY and art projects
  • Travel journals 
  • and more

Here is an example of how the Story block looks:

When a visitor to your site clicks on the story preview, the story autoplays in a full-screen view. Visitors can reply to your story by commenting on or liking the post.

A Story viewed fullscreen

Stories on WordPress are different from stories on other platforms in a few ways. 

  • Posts with Stories won’t disappear after 24 hours. 
  • The story content can be added to and edited after publishing. 
  • Anyone visiting your site can view the Story. 
  • You can share your story on any platform using the post permalink.

Create a story

You can create a story using the WordPress editor on the web (not the mobile app).

Add a Story block

To add a Story block, click the + block inserter button and search for the Story block. You can also quickly type /story and press enter.

For more information, visit our detailed instructions on adding blocks.

Add images and videos to a story

When you add a Story block, you’re given two options:

  • Upload: Add new media or multiple media files from your computer to your website. Supported media are images and videos.
  • Select Media: Choose from:

The order of the images in your story is determined by the order in which you select the images.
